The solar garden stake showcases a beautifully crafted fairy holding a delicate watering can, creating a whimsical and enchanting garden accent
Integrated fairy lights stream from the spout of the watering can, powered by an efficient solar panel that charges during the day and automatically illuminates at dusk
Made from high-quality, weather-resistant materials, this solar decorative stake is designed to withstand outdoor conditions while maintaining its vibrant colors and details
Simply place the stake in a sunny spot in your garden or flowerbed—no wiring or batteries needed. The solar panel ensures hassle-free operation with minimal upkeep
The soft glow of the solar fairy lights creates a dreamy, magical atmosphere, perfect for enhancing garden pathways, patios, or outdoor living spaces after dark
